Evaluation of thrombin generation in dogs administered clopidogrel

TL;DR: Thrombin generation performed on platelet poor plasma may not be a useful antiplatelet monitoring tool in dogs, despite concomitant changes in TEG-PM variables consistent with platelet inhibition. (via Semantic Scholar)

IntroductionThe antiplatelet effect of clopidogrel can vary between patients. A modified thromboelastography (TEG) protocol (TEG-Platelet Mapping assay® [TEG-PM]) can be used for clopidogrel monitoring but is not widely available. Thrombin generation (TG) assays could offer a novel alternative. The main objective of this pilot study was to assess TG assay variables (lag time, peak, endogenous thrombin potential [ETP]) in dogs before and after 7 days of clopidogrel administration and compare with TEG-PM variables (maximum amplitude [MA]-ADP and percentage (%) inhibition).
